在处理文本文件时,我们经常会遇到需要删除空白行的情况,这些空白行的存在不仅影响文件的可读性,还占据了宝贵的空间。本文将介绍一种高效批量删除空白行的方法,以帮助读者简化操作,提升工作效率。
一、使用正则表达式进行空白行匹配
通过使用正则表达式,可以轻松地匹配出空白行,并进行删除操作。利用正则表达式中的特殊字符和模式匹配规则,可以快速定位并删除文本中的空白行。
二、使用文本编辑器的批量替换功能
现代文本编辑器通常都提供了强大的批量替换功能,可以帮助我们快速找到并删除空白行。通过合理运用文本编辑器的搜索和替换功能,可以大大简化操作流程,提高效率。
三、使用Python脚本实现自动化删除
如果你有一大批需要处理的文本文件,手动逐个删除空白行无疑是繁琐且低效的。这时,可以考虑编写一个Python脚本来实现自动化的批量删除操作,大大提升处理效率。
四、使用命令行工具进行空白行删除
命令行工具是一种高效的处理文本文件的方式,通过简单的命令即可完成对文本中空白行的删除。这种方式适用于熟悉命令行操作的用户,可以快速完成大量文本文件的处理。
五、使用Excel的宏功能进行空白行删除
如果你的工作需要频繁处理Excel表格中的空白行,那么可以考虑利用Excel的宏功能来进行批量删除。通过录制和执行宏,可以一键删除所有空白行,提高工作效率。
六、使用在线工具进行空白行删除
如果你只需要偶尔处理一两个文件,而不想下载和安装复杂的软件,那么可以选择使用在线工具进行空白行删除。这些在线工具通常提供简单直观的操作界面,方便快捷。
七、注意事项:备份原始文件
在进行批量删除空白行操作之前,务必备份原始文件。因为删除操作是不可逆的,一旦误删可能无法恢复。通过备份原始文件,可以保证数据的安全性。
八、注意事项:排除特殊情况
在删除空白行时,有时会遇到一些特殊情况,比如带有空格的非空行。为了避免误删这些行,需要在操作之前仔细检查文件的内容,并针对特殊情况进行相应的处理。
九、注意事项:文件格式的影响
不同的文件格式在空白行删除操作上可能存在差异。在选择删除方法时,需要考虑文件的具体格式(如txt、csv、xlsx等),以确保操作的有效性。
十、注意事项:检查删除结果
在完成空白行删除操作后,务必仔细检查删除结果。确保所有空白行都被正确删除,并且没有误删非空行。
十一、注意事项:批量删除与单个删除的差异
批量删除空白行与单个文件删除空白行有时会存在差异。在进行批量操作时,需要额外注意操作的正确性和完整性。
十二、实例演示:使用正则表达式进行空白行删除
通过一个具体的实例演示,详细介绍使用正则表达式进行空白行删除的具体步骤和注意事项。
十三、实例演示:使用Python脚本实现自动化删除
通过一个具体的实例演示,介绍如何使用Python脚本来实现自动化的批量删除操作,并提供完整的代码示例。
十四、实例演示:使用命令行工具进行空白行删除
通过一个具体的实例演示,介绍如何使用命令行工具进行空白行删除,并提供常用命令的解释和使用方法。
十五、
通过本文的介绍,我们了解到了多种批量删除空白行的方法,包括正则表达式、文本编辑器、Python脚本、命令行工具和在线工具等。不同的方法适用于不同的场景,读者可以根据自己的需求选择合适的方法来提升工作效率。同时,在进行操作之前需要注意备份原始文件,排除特殊情况,检查删除结果等注意事项,以确保操作的准确性和完整性。删除空白行虽然是一项看似简单的操作,但却能够帮助我们提高文本处理的效率,使工作变得更加轻松。